Handover for Alertfold dedup service. Dedup window raised to 90s after the Bramblewick incident; don't lower it before release 7.3. Known issue: duplicate pages still leak when two regions flap simultaneously — fix is in review. Release gate: ship only after the suppression-rule audit passes. Dashboards under ops/alertfold. If the dedup cache needs a cold restart, the admin CLI will prompt before wiping state; it accepts the recovery passphrase below.

recovery phrase for bafof-kajof: quenmir-ralmir-praeth

**Q: What actually caused the stale-cache incident in Larkspool last quarter?**

Short version: the invalidation worker and the write path disagreed about key casing, so roughly 12% of entries never got purged. Users saw day-old prices and, understandably, filed tickets. The fix normalized keys at write time and added a canary that diffs cache against source hourly. If the canary alarms, don't just flush everything — read the postmortem first. The full writeup with timelines is on the page below.

runbook for kahof-yaweg: https://superset.tolvaqdyn.test/settings/repo/projects/display/68a0f19bdd1535be

## Sensor drift: what to do at 3am

If the GrowLoop controller starts reporting humidity swings that don't match the backup probes in the Fernwick greenhouse, it's almost always sensor drift, not an actual climate event. Don't panic and don't touch the vents manually. First, restart the calibration daemon and give it ten minutes to re-baseline. If readings still disagree by more than 5%, flip the controller into safe mode. The safe-mode thresholds it will use are these.

config for yahap-bajof:
[istix]
host = istix.qorvelsys.internal
user = istix_svc
database = istix_prod

We are in early, non-binding discussions to acquire Bryndell Instruments, a regional supplier of calibration equipment based in Welkermoor. The attraction is their installed base and service contracts, which complement our Veralux line. Due diligence has not begun; no terms are agreed. Customer-facing teams must not alter Bryndell-related conversations or pricing in the interim. Any inbound questions should be deflected without comment. The strategic intent is summarised in the note below.

internal memo for kawip-hadug: Headcount on the Wenwyn team goes from 7 to 140 by the end of January. Gross margin on Wenwyn came in at 20 percent against a plan of 15 percent.